    What if starting an outdoor hospitality business didn't require land, cabins, permits, or a six-figure investment? In this episode, Sarah Riley speaks with Adam Odgaard from Isabella Camping about the Camp-Let tent trailer… a clever Danish invention that has been popular across Europe for decades but is only now arriving in the United States. We explore how this lightweight trailer (just 595 lbs) unfolds into a surprisingly spacious camping setup with sleeping cabins and living space, and why it's attracting attention as a new business opportunity in the outdoor hospitality industry. They discuss: The fascinating 70-year history of Isabella, a family business founded in Denmark How the Camp-Let trailer bridges the gap between camping and glamping Why its lightweight design works perfectly with electric vehicles The growing opportunity for mobile outdoor hospitality businesses How some operators in Europe already use these trailers as rental units on campsites A potential low-cost entry point into the outdoor hospitality industry Adam also shares example numbers showing how a Camp-Let setup could potentially reach break-even in around a year, opening up new possibilities for entrepreneurs who want to help people experience nature without needing to own land.     In this episode, Sarah Riley talks with Chris Jeub of Monument Glamping… a familiar name in the industry and one of the early voices helping landowners turn beautiful properties into outdoor hospitality businesses. Chris shares the remarkable story of how a simple idea in 2019, of moving his bedroom into a hunting tent during a home remodel, unexpectedly became a fully-fledged glamping operation that now spans two properties and dozens of permitted units. Together, Sarah and Chris dive into the realities behind building a glamping business from scratch: navigating county regulations, dealing with neighbour complaints, expanding with container homes, and turning backyard tents into a six-figure enterprise. Chris also explains the powerful mindset shift that allowed him to reposition his offering, double his nightly rates, and transform Monument Glamping into an experience-led brand rooted in reconnection and simplicity.
